Use of the myocutaneous serratus anterior free flap for reconstruction after salvage glossectomy

Abstract

Purpose

To describe the use of a myocutaneous serratus anterior free flap (SAFF) for tongue reconstruction after salvage subtotal (STG) and total glossectomy (TG).

Methods

In this prospective case series, seven patients underwent salvage STG or TG and reconstruction with a myocutaneous SAFF between 10/2015 and 02/2017. Functional and oncologic outcomes were prospectively evaluated. Donor side morbidity was determined using the Disabilities of the Arm, Shoulder and Hand (DASH) score.

Results

SAFF with mean skin paddles of 6.7 cm × 8.7 cm was used in five STG and two TG patients, respectively. There was a 100% flap survival and a mean DASH score of 10.8 reflected normal arm and shoulder function after surgery. One year after salvage surgery, 1 (14.3%) and 4 (57.1%) patients were tracheostomy and gastrostomy tube dependent. Gastrostomy tube dependence was significantly worse in patients with tumors of the base of tongue compared to other tumor sites (p = 0.030) and in patients who underwent transcervical compared to transoral tumor resection (p = 0.008). Local recurrence rate was 57.1% with a disease-free survival of 17.6 months.

Conclusion

The myocutaneous SAFF represents a safe and reliable flap for tongue reconstruction after salvage glossectomy with satisfying functional outcomes and low donor side morbidity.

Association between treatment delays and oncologic outcome in patients treated with surgery and radiotherapy for head and neck cancer

Abstract

Background

This study sought to determine the oncologic impact of delays to surgery, radiotherapy, and completion of therapy in patients with head and neck squamous cell carcinoma.

Methods

The impact of biopsy to surgery (BTS) time, surgery to start of radiation time (STSR), and radiation treatment time (RTT) on locoregional recurrence (LRR), distant metastases (DMs), and cancer‐specific mortality (CSM) was examined. The cumulative incidences (CI) of LRR, DMs, and CSM were examined using Fine–Gray testing.

Results

A total of 277 patients treated with surgery and adjuvant radiotherapy were analyzed. On multivariable testing, BTS >50 days was associated with DM (P = .03), whereas RTT and STSR were not. RTT >43 days was associated with LRR (P = .02) in patients with non‐p16‐positive‐oropharynx cancer.

Conclusions

An increase in DM appears to be the mechanism by which prolonged time to treatment initiation leads to worse overall survival. Prolonged RTT has the greatest impact on patients with non‐p16 positive oropharynx cancers.

Detection of Epstein–Barr virus (EBV)‐encoded microRNAs in plasma of patients with nasopharyngeal carcinoma

Abstract

Background

Nasopharyngeal carcinoma (NPC) latently infected by Epstein–Barr virus (EBV) expresses 40 EBV BART microRNAs (miRNAs). Difference in diagnostic efficacy of these miRNAs on NPC detection was observed. Here, we performed a comprehensive evaluation on the efficacy of these miRNAs.

Methods

Quantitative polymerase chain reaction was performed on plasma nucleic acid isolated from patients with NPC and noncancer donors.

Results

For primary NPC, BART2‐5P, BART6‐3P, BART7‐3P, BART7‐5P, BART9‐5P, BART11‐3P, BART17‐5P, and BART19‐5P were significantly elevated. For recurrent NPC, plasma levels of BART2‐3P, BART2‐5P, BART5‐3P, BART5‐5P, BART6‐3P, BART8‐3P, BART9‐5P, BART17‐5P, BART19‐3P, and BART20‐3P were significantly increased. Area under curve (AUC) analysis showed that BART19‐5P had the best performance to identify NPC which was serologically EBV DNA undetectable. For recurrent NPC, BART8‐3P and BART10‐3P had highest AUC value for identifying cancer in EBV DNA undetectable plasma.

Conclusion

Our data supported the use of circulating EBV miRNAs in NPC and recurrent NPC detection.

18F‐FDG PET/MRI vs MRI in patients with recurrent adenoid cystic carcinoma

Abstract

Objectives

To evaluate and compare the diagnostic potential of 18F‐fluorodeoxyglucose positron emission tomography/magnetic resonance imaging (18FDG‐PET/MRI) and MRI for recurrence diagnostics after primary therapy in patients with adenoid cystic carcinoma (ACC).

Methods

A total of 32 dedicated head and neck 18F‐FDG PET/MRI datasets were included in this analysis. MRI and 18F‐FDG PET/MRI datasets were analyzed in separate sessions by two readers for tumor recurrence or metastases.

Results

Lesion‐based sensitivity, specificity, positive predictive value, negative predictive value and diagnostic accuracy were 96%, 84%, 90%, 93%, and 91% for 18F‐FDG PET/MRI and 77%, 94%, 95%, 73%, and 84% for MRI, resulting in a significantly higher diagnostic accuracy of 18F‐FDG PET/MRI compared to MRI (P < .005).

Conclusion

18F‐FDG PET/MRI is superior to MRI in detecting local recurrence and metastases in patients with ACC of the head and neck. Especially concerning its negative predictive value, 18F‐FDG PET/MRI outperforms MRI.

Plasma metabolite profiling and chemometric analyses of tobacco snuff dippers and patients with oral cancer: Relationship between metabolic signatures

Abstract

Background

Cancer of oral cavity is a seriously growing problem in many parts of the world. In Indian subcontinent, most of these cases have been attributed to the use of tobacco‐related products. This study is focused on the identification of distinguishing metabolites of oral cancer in comparison with tobacco snuff dippers and healthy controls.

Methods

A total of 234 plasma samples including 62 healthy controls, 81 tobacco snuff dippers, and 91 oral cancer samples were analyzed using mass spectrometry.

Results

Twenty‐nine of 3326 metabolites were found to distinguish among oral cancer, tobacco snuff dippers, and healthy controls using P‐value ≤.001 and fold change ≥3. Prediction model was generated with an overall accuracy of 89.3%. Two metabolites, that is, stearyl alcohol and sucrose, can be used as predictive biomarkers showing progression of tobacco snuff dippers toward oral cancer.

Conclusion

The unique metabolite profile gives evidence of a strong correlation between tobacco snuff dipping and oral cancer.

Trends in Female Leadership at High‐Profile Otolaryngology Journals, 1997–2017

Objectives

To determine the proportion and relative advancement of women in leadership positions at high‐impact otolaryngology journals.

Methods

Nine clinical otolaryngology journals were selected based on high impact factor and subspecialty representation (journal impact factor, 2016: 1.16–2.95). The proportion of women editorial board members associate and/or section editors, and/or editor‐in‐chief was measured from 1997 to 2017. Comparisons were made to the proportion of women otolaryngology faculty at U.S. medical schools in 2017.

Results

From 1997 to 2017, female editorial board membership increased from 7.2% (range: 0.0%–12.8%) to 17.7% (range: 10.9%–38.9%) (P = 0.0001). In 2017, the proportion of female editorial board members was significantly less than the proportion of female academic otolaryngology faculty (17.7% vs. 27.7%, P = 0.0001), and there was threefold variation between journals. From 1997 to 2017, the proportion of female associate and/or section editors increased from 9.3% (range: 0.0–27.3) to 20.9% (range: 5.3% to 45.5%) (P = 0.09). In 2017, the proportion of female associate and/or section editors was not significantly different than the proportion of female associate or full professor academic otolaryngology faculty (20.9% vs. 19.5%, P = 0.73), but there was ninefold variation between journals.

Conclusion

Women were underrepresented on eight of nine otolaryngology editorial boards but appropriately represented at the associate and/or section editorship level. There was remarkable variation in representation at individual journals, which may provide future opportunities to examine best practices. Disparity exists in leadership at the most senior level of these high‐profile otolaryngology journals: none had women editor‐in‐chiefs.

How Much Blood Could a JP Suck If a JP Could Suck Blood?

Objective

Active surgical drains minimize fluid accumulation in the postoperative period. The Jackson‐Pratt (JP) system consists of a silicone drain connected by flexible tubing to a bulb. When air in the bulb is evacuated, negative pressure is applied at the surgical site to aspirate fluid. The objective of this study was to determine if the evacuation method and volume of accumulated fluid affect the pressure generated by the bulb.

Methods

Bulbs were connected to a digital manometer under various experimental conditions. A random number generator determined the initial evacuation method for each bulb, either side‐in or bottom‐up. Subsequent evacuations were alternated until data was collected in triplicate for each method. Predetermined amounts of water were placed into the bulb; air was evacuated; and pressure was recorded. The digital manometer was allowed to equilibrate for 1 minute prior to data acquisition.

Results

The average amount of pressure after a side‐in evacuation of a JP bulb was 87.4 cm H2O compared to 17.7 cm H2O for a bottom‐up evacuation (P < 0.0001). When the drain contained 25 mL, 50 mL, 75 mL, and 100 mL of fluid, the pressure applied dropped to 72.6, 41.3, 37.0, and 35.6 cm H2O, respectively.

Conclusions

JP drains generate negative pressure in order to reduce fluid accumulation at surgical sites. Although its function is frequently taken for granted, this study demonstrates that both the specific method for evacuating the bulb as well as the amount of fluid in the bulb significantly affect the performance of this device.

Immunologic modification in mono‐ and poly‐sensitized patients after sublingual immunotherapy

Objectives/Hypothesis

To compare immunologic modification and treatment outcomes after 2 years of sublingual immunotherapy (SLIT) with house dust mite extracts (HDM) between monosensitized and polysensitized patients with allergic rhinitis.

Study Design

Retrospective cohort study.

Methods

Among the patients who were prospectively enrolled in the SLIT cohort study, patients with allergic rhinitis who were sensitized to HDM and treated with SLIT for at least 2 years were studied. All participants underwent serologic tests at baseline and after SLIT to evaluate changes in immunologic parameters. The total nasal symptom score (TNSS) was measured before and after SLIT, and effective and less effective responder groups were categorized depending on whether patients had a TNSS reduction of 50%, as compared with baseline.

Results

The increase in Dermatophagoides pteronyssinus and Dermatophagoides farinae specific immunoglobulin G4 levels was significantly higher in monosensitized patients than in polysensitized patients (P = .020 and P = .005, respectively). The TNSS significantly improved after SLIT in both the monosensitized and polysensitized groups (P < .001 in both groups). However, the difference in the changes in TNSS from baseline was not significant between the two groups (P = .374).

Conclusions

This study demonstrated different immunologic modifications after SLIT between monosensitized and polysensitized patients. However, patients in the polysensitized group who were treated with single‐allergen SLIT experienced clinical improvement in TNSS that was comparable with that in the monosensitized group despite demonstrating different immunologic changes.

Transoral rigid 70‐degree laryngoscopy in a pediatric voice clinic

Objective

Complaints of dysphonia and dysphagia frequently require rigid or flexible laryngoscopy in the office to aid in diagnosis. For young children, flexible laryngoscopy can be uncomfortable and often requires multiple adults to restrain the child. Rigid laryngoscopy does not result in crying but does require patient cooperation; thus, it is used primarily in adults. This project describes our experience using rigid laryngoscopy in a pediatric cohort.

Methods

This was a retrospective chart review of patients at a pediatric voice clinic who underwent laryngoscopy from December 2011 through March 2017. Data analysis is via Student t test and descriptive analysis.

Results

Three hundred and eleven patients were identified with 423 unique laryngoscopy exams. Of those, 212 of the exams were flexible and 210 were rigid. One patient did not tolerate either rigid or flexible exam. There was a statistically significant difference in age between children diagnosed via rigid mean 10.92 years (range 2.39–19.14 years) versus flexible mean 6.51 years (range 0.41–19.29 years), P ≤ 0.01. Of the 44 children under 3 years of age, flexible laryngoscopy was used almost exclusively, with 43 of 44 (97.7%) flexible scope exams. Rigid laryngoscopy was performed on 24 of 115 (20.9%) children aged 3 to 5 years, 26 of 40 (65%) aged 6 years, and 159 of 223 (71.3%) aged 7 and older.

Conclusion

Transoral 70o rigid laryngoscopy can be used in select children as young as 3 years of age. This modality allows for improved visualization of lesions with greater comfort for patients. Laryngoscope, 2018

Impact of Balloon Diameter on Dilation Outcomes in a Model of Rabbit Subglottic Stenosis

Objective

To determine the appropriate balloon size for dilation using a previously described reproducible survival animal model of subglottic stenosis.

Study Design

Prospective animal study.

Methods

We conducted a prospective study including 16 New Zealand White rabbits. The airway of each animal was sized with an endotracheal tube (ETT), and subglottic stenosis (SGS) was endoscopically induced using Bugbee electrocautery to 75% of the circumference of the subglottis, followed by 4‐hour intubation. Two weeks postoperatively, the rabbits' airways were sized and then dilated using a 6‐, 7‐, 8‐, or 9‐mm balloon, with four animals in each experimental group. Following dilation, animals were again sized and subsequently euthanized. The cricoid lumen was measured microscopically in each animal.

Results

Prior to inducing stenosis, all animals were sized with a 3.5 ETT. After inducing injury but prior to dilation, airways showed grade 2 SGS that sized with a 2.5 ETT with no leak. Postdilation, animals dilated with 6‐ or 7‐mm balloons (n = 8) sized with a 3.0 ETT, and animals dilated with an 8‐ or 9‐mm balloon (n = 8) sized with a 3.5 ETT. Postdilation median cricoid lumen measurements were 12.5 mm2 (6‐mm balloon), 13.92 mm2 (7 mm), 16.83 mm2 (8 mm), and 17.15 mm2 (9 mm); two cricoid fractures occurred in the 9‐mm group.

Conclusion

The postdilation cricoid lumen diameter increased with increased balloon size, and the use of an 8‐mm balloon achieved the largest cricoid lumen diameter without causing fracture. Further research is necessary to determine the ideal duration of dilation and optimal intervals between dilations.

Isolated Recovery of Adductor Muscle Function Following Bilateral Recurrent Laryngeal Nerve Injuries

Objectives/Hypothesis

The aim of this study was to analyze the phoniatric and respiratory outcomes of a subset of bilateral vocal cord paralysis (BVCP) patients who were all treated with unilateral endoscopic arytenoid abduction lateropexy (EAAL). EAAL is a nondestructive, minimally invasive glottis widening operation, which does not damage either the surgically treated or the contralateral vocal cord. Therefore, it does not impair the regeneration potential of the recurrent laryngeal nerve.

Study Design

Case series.

Methods

Ten out of 21 BVCP patients who were treated with EAAL showed signs of isolated adduction recovery at 1 year and were chosen for this study. Functional results (objective and subjective voice analysis, spirometric measurement) and vocal cord movements were assessed preoperatively, 1 week and 1 year after EAAL. Laryngeal electromyography was performed on the 12th postoperative month.

Results

The volitional adductor movement seen on laryngoscopy was corroborated by laryngeal electromyography evaluation. Peak inspiratory flow increased significantly after EAAL. Quality‐of‐life scores also showed high patient satisfaction. Shimmer showed consistent improvement along with harmonic‐to‐noise ratio and average maximal phonation time in parallel with the improving vocal cord movement. Complex voice analysis and subjective self‐evaluation tests also demonstrated significant improvement.

Conclusions

EAAL, as a minimally invasive, nondestructive airway widening technique, does not interfere with the potential regeneration process that can still occur after BVCP, allowing for laryngeal functional recovery. It is a safe and effective treatment for BVCP that allows a simple solution with good phonatory, swallowing, and respiratory benefits by unilateral passive and reversible vocal cord lateralization.

Vestibular atelectasis: Decoding pressure and sound‐induced nystagmus with bilateral vestibulopathy

We present the case of a 27‐year‐old male who presented with vertigo when pressing the entrance of his right auditory meatus and exposing his right ear to loud noise. A diagnostic procedure revealed bilateral labyrinth weakness, which was confirmed by caloric and rotational testing. The ocular vestibular evoked myogenic potentials investigation demonstrated a significant weakness of the right utriculus, whereas the cervical vestibular evoked myogenic potentials were normal, indicating preservation of the saccular response. Radiologic studies did not show evidence of labyrinthine dehiscence. We suspect the newly described association of this clinical syndrome with the previously described histopathology of vestibular atelectasis accounts for these findings. Laryngoscope, 2018

Office‐based transnasal esophagoscopy biopsies for histological diagnosis of head and neck patients

Objectives/Hypothesis

To present yield of transnasal esophagoscopy (TNE) biopsies of upper aerodigestive tract (UADT) lesions and define the role of TNE as a safe alternative to rigid endoscopy.

Study Design

Retrospective case series.

Methods

All patients who underwent TNE‐guided biopsies attempted over a 2‐year period were included. Patients were identified using coding records and outpatient diaries. Demographic data were recorded as well as the histological diagnosis and additional histological diagnostic procedures.

Results

During the observation period, 134 TNE‐guided procedures were attempted. The procedure could not be completed in 19 patients. There were 102/115 (89%) patients who did not require further interventions for histological diagnosis of the tumor. The most common biopsied area was the larynx (53), followed by the tongue base (29). The most common malignancy was invasive squamous cell carcinoma in 42/115 (36.5%).

Conclusions

The work presented in this article strongly suggests that TNE‐guided biopsy is a valuable diagnostic tool for patients suspected of having carcinoma of the UADT.

Vocal fold botulinum toxin injection for refractory paradoxical vocal fold motion disorder

Objective

Demonstrate efficacy of vocal fold botulinum toxin injection for treatment of refractory paradoxical vocal fold motion disorder (PVFMD).

Methods

A retrospective review was completed of patients diagnosed with PVFMD who underwent vocal fold botulinum toxin injection for dyspnea symptoms that persisted despite laryngeal control therapy, medical management, and biofeedback therapy. Outcomes measured included overall improvement and resolution of dyspnea symptoms, number of botulinum toxin injections and dose range, change in dyspnea severity index (DSI) scores, and adverse effects of injection therapy.

Results

Thirteen patients (9 female/4 male) underwent vocal fold botulinum toxin injection for refractory PVFMD. The average dose was 2.55 units per vocal fold (range 1.75–5.5 units). The average number of injections was 3.85 (range 1–12 injections). Eleven of 13 (84.6%) patients experienced improvement in dyspnea symptoms, with two of 11 (18.2%) having complete resolution of symptoms. There was a statistically significant improvement in DSI scores because the mean preinjection DSI was 30.43 and improved to 17.43 postinjection (P = 0.017). Temporary breathy voice quality was experienced by all patients with no other adverse side effects.

Conclusion

Vocal fold botulinum toxin injection is a safe and effective treatment option for PVFMD and should be considered in patients with refractory dyspnea symptoms following appropriate medical therapy and respiratory retraining protocols.

Using craniofacial characteristics to predict optimum airway pressure in obstructive sleep apnea treatment

Publication date: Available online 12 December 2018

Source: Brazilian Journal of Otorhinolaryngology

Author(s): Thays Crosara Abrahão Cunha, Thais Moura Guimarães, Fernanda R. Almeida, Fernanda L.M. Haddad, Luciana B.M. Godoy, Thulio M. Cunha, Luciana O. Silva, Sergio Tufik, Lia Bittencourt

Abstract
Introduction

Manual titration is the gold standard to determinate optimal continuous positive airway pressure, and the prediction of the optimal pressure is important to avoid delays in prescribing a continuous positive airway pressure treatment.

Objective

To verify whether anthropometric, polysomnographic, cephalometric, and upper airway clinical assessments can predict the optimal continuous positive airway pressure setting for obstructive sleep apnea patients.

Methods

Fifty men between 25 and 65 years, with body mass indexes of less than or equal to 35 kg/m2 were selected. All patients had baseline polysomnography followed by cephalometric and otolaryngological clinical assessments. On a second night, titration polysomnography was carried out to establish the optimal pressure.

Results

The average age of the patients was 43 ± 12.3 years, with a mean body mass index of 27.1 ± 3.4 kg/m2 and an apnea–hypopnea index of 17.8 ± 10.5 events/h. Smaller mandibular length (p = 0.03), smaller atlas–jaw distance (p = 0.03), and the presence of a Mallampati III and IV (p = 0.02) were predictors for higher continuous positive airway pressure. The formula for the optimal continuous positive airway pressure was: 17.244 − (0.133 × jaw length) + (0.969 × Mallampati III and IV classification) − (0.926 × atlas–jaw distance).

Conclusion

In a sample of male patients with mild-to-moderate obstructive sleep apnea, the optimal continuous positive airway pressure was predicted using the mandibular length, atlas–jaw distance and Mallampati classification.

The effect of very low dose pulsed magnetic waves on cochlea

Publication date: Available online 12 December 2018

Source: Brazilian Journal of Otorhinolaryngology

Author(s): Birgül Tuhanioğlu, Sanem Okşan Erkan, Seren Gülşen Gürgen, Talih Özdaş, Orhan Görgülü, Figen Çiçekc, İsmail Günay

Abstract
Introduction

In daily life biological systems are usually exposed to magnetic field forces at different intensities and frequencies, either directly or indirectly. Despite negative results, the therapeutic use of the low dose magnetic field has been found in recent studies. The effect of magnetic field forces on cochlear cells is not clear in the literature.

Objective

In our study, we first applied in vivo pulsed magnetic fields to laboratory rats to investigate the effects on cochlea with distortion product otoacoustic emission test followed by histopathological examinations.

Methods

Twelve rats were included in this study, separated into two groups as study group and control group. The rats in the study group were exposed to 40 Hz pulsed magnetic field for 1 h/day for 30 days; the hearing of the rats was controlled by otoacoustic emission test. Also, their cochleas were removed and histochemical examination was performed by Caspase-3, Caspase-9, and TUNEL methods.

Results

A statistically significant difference was determined (p < 0.05) when the hearing thresholds of the groups obtained by using 5714 Hz and 8000 Hz stimuli were compared by Kruskal–Wallis test. A significant reaction was observed in the study group, especially in the outer ciliated cells during immunohistochemical examinations by using Caspase-3 and Caspase-9 methods. A significantly positive difference was determined in the study group, especially at the outer ciliated cells and the support cells of the corti organ, when compared to the control group (p < 0.05) by the TUNEL method.

Conclusion

According to the results of our study, the very low dose magnetic field, which is considered to be used for therapeutic purposes recently, can cause both auditory function defects and histopathologic damage in cochlear cells.

A systematic review of current methodology of high resolution pharyngeal manometry with and without impedance

Abstract

Purpose

This systematic review appraises and summaries methodology documented in studies using high resolution pharyngeal manometry (HRM) with and without impedance technology (HRIM) in adult populations.

Methods

Four electronic databases CINAHL, EMBASE, MEDLINE, and Cochrane Library were searched up to, and including March 2017. Studies reporting pharyngeal HRM/HRIM for swallowing and/or phonatory assessment, published in peer-reviewed journals in English, German, or Spanish were assessed for the inclusion criteria. Of the selected studies, methodological aspects of data acquisition and analysis were extracted. Publications were graded based on their level of evidence and quality of methodological aspects was assessed.

Results

Sixty-two articles were identified eligible, from which 50 studies reported the use of HRM and 12 studies used HRIM. Of all included manuscripts, the majority utilized the ManoScan™ system (64.5%), a catheter diameter of 4.2 mm was most prevalently documented (30.6%). Most publications reported the application of topical anesthesia (53.2%). For data analysis in studies using HRM, software intrinsic to the recording system was reported most frequently (56%). A minority of the studies using HRM provided data about measurement reliability (10%). This is higher for studies using HRIM (50%).

Conclusions

Considerable methodological variability exists regarding data acquisition and analysis in published studies using HRM/HRIM. Lacking reports of methodology make study replications difficult and reduce the comparability across studies. More data regarding the impact of individual methodological aspects on study outcomes are further required for the development of methodological recommendations.
